The bond between the Military Mountain Divisions and the National Ski Patrol remains strong. Back in January, the 172nd Mountain Infantry Division of the New Hampshire Army National Guard conducted joint training operations with the National Ski Patrol at Waterville Valley Resort. The two sides were working on various mountain rescue scenarios, such as simulated cold-weather CPR training.
